Output 2c107d5efbc592056fc28d03c4c070eb9ab2b27c9011a75680156094b5a8c1ce:11

value
39500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ab99ce3b58fb668636cd6faddc6e3992342045ea OP_EQUAL
address
MPYW2qGxGTymQg2cpdiLgHuV9ydDu4bQii
transaction
2c107d5efbc592056fc28d03c4c070eb9ab2b27c9011a75680156094b5a8c1ce
spent
true